Victoria Beckham recalls moment Beyonce revealed how Spice Girls inspired her career


Beyonce told Victoria Beckham that the Spice Girls were part of the reason why she wanted to become a singer (Picture: Kevin Winter/Getty Images for The Recording Academy)

The Spice Girls inspired a generation with their Girl Power message – including the one and only Beyonce.

Yep, turns out Queen Bey was inspired by the iconic British girl group and she made sure to let Victoria Beckham know this when they bumped into each other a few years ago.

Victoria recalled the moment during her appearance on Dear Media’s Breaking Beauty podcast as she said: ‘I met Beyonce a few years ago, and she actually said to me, “It was the Spice Girls that inspired me and made me want to do what I do and made me proud to be a girl and proud to be who I am”.’

The 47-year-old fashion designer continued: ‘And when someone like Beyonce, who is so iconic and was such a strong woman, says that she was inspired by the Spice Girls, I think that’s quite something.’

Indeed, Beyonce has gone on to keep the girl power message going strong so the revelation had to have been a nice boost for VB and her fellow bandmates.

Looking back at the impact she had on both the music and fashion world as Posh Spice in the 90s group, Victoria added: ‘I don’t look at anything and cringe.

The Spice Girls’ iconic Girl Power message is still going strong (Picture: Rex)

‘I look at us all, and it makes me smile because we didn’t care. Whether it was fashion or beauty, we didn’t care. We wore what made us feel good. We weren’t worried is this the newest, coolest? We set trends because there was no fear.’

VB revealed she could never get into the thick platform boots that her fellow bandmates Mel B, Emma Bunton, Geri Halliwell, and Melanie Chisholm’s help to make so iconic.

However, she still got to benefit due to the differing style as the Victoria Beckham Beauty founder added: ‘It worked for me the fact the girls wore those shoes because they used to get sent them for free because they were not that expensive.

‘So therefore there was a little more budget left over for me to have those Tom Ford, Gucci spike-heeled stilettos that Posh used to trotter around in.’
